The Allis Chalmers 310 is a garden tractor produced from 1971 to 1973 as part of the 300 Series. It features a 10 hp Kohler 391cc 1-cylinder gasoline air-cooled engine, a 21-speed belt-driven variator transmission, and two-wheel drive with manual steering. The tractor has an open operator station and is built in Lexington, South Carolina, USA. It includes an independent front PTO with manual clutch and optional electric PTO. The 310 supports a 42-inch mid-mount mower deck with manual or optional electric lift. Dimensions include a 48.1 inch wheelbase, 74 inch length, and 794 lbs weight. Tires are 4.80-4.00x8 front and 23-8.50x12 rear. Electrical system is 12 volts with alternator charging at 15 amps. The serial number tag is located on the left side of the tractor frame.
